从node.js驱动中获取Update/Insert语句的返回可以通过以下步骤实现:
affectedRows
属性来获取受影响的行数;对于PostgreSQL,你可以使用rowCount
属性来获取受影响的行数;对于MongoDB,你可以使用result
对象来获取详细的执行结果。以下是一个示例代码,演示如何从Node.js驱动中获取Update/Insert语句的返回:
const mysql = require('mysql');
const connection = mysql.createConnection({
host: 'localhost',
user: 'your_username',
password: 'your_password',
database: 'your_database'
});
connection.connect();
const sql = 'UPDATE your_table SET column1 = value1 WHERE condition';
connection.query(sql, (error, results) => {
if (error) {
console.error(error);
} else {
console.log(`Affected rows: ${results.affectedRows}`);
}
});
connection.end();
在上面的示例中,我们使用了MySQL的Node.js驱动程序来执行一个Update语句,并在回调函数中打印受影响的行数。
请注意,具体的代码实现可能因使用的数据库驱动程序和语法而有所不同。你需要根据你使用的具体驱动程序和数据库来查阅相关文档,以获取更详细的信息和示例代码。
推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云数据库PostgreSQL、腾讯云数据库MongoDB等。你可以通过访问腾讯云官方网站获取更多关于这些产品的详细信息和文档链接。
领取专属 10元无门槛券
手把手带您无忧上云